Govt warns private airlines on fog preparations Tuesday, December 27 2005 13:50 Hrs (IST) - World Time -
New Delhi:
Government today (Dec 27, 2005) asked private airlines to heed to the needs of the passengers stranded due to fog at the Delhi airport and warned that they may not be given any flights in or out of Delhi in the next winter schedule if this was not done.
"We have told them that they should take necessary steps (including training pilots under the Instrument Landing System CAT lll-B). If they don't do so, we may consider not to give them flights in and out of Delhi in the next winter schedule," Civil Aviation Secretary Ajay Prasad told reporters here.
